1. Coastal Climate: The Sea’s Influence on Dalian’s Weather
The proximity to the Yellow Sea significantly impacts Dalian’s climate, creating a microclimate that’s quite different from inland areas. The sea acts as a natural thermostat, moderating temperatures and bringing humidity to the region. This means Dalian experiences milder winters and cooler summers compared to other cities at similar latitudes. 🌊
However, the sea also brings its challenges. During the summer, Dalian can experience typhoons and heavy rainfall, which can disrupt daily life. Yet, it’s this very unpredictability that keeps weather enthusiasts on their toes, eagerly checking forecasts for the latest updates. 🌀
2. Seasonal Changes: From Frosty Winters to Blossoming Springs
Dalian’s four distinct seasons are a sight to behold. Winter in Dalian is cold and dry, with temperatures often dropping below freezing. The city transforms into a winter wonderland, perfect for those who enjoy the crisp air and snow-covered landscapes. However, spring quickly follows, bringing with it a burst of color as flowers bloom and the city warms up. 🌼
Summer in Dalian is relatively mild compared to other parts of China, making it a popular destination for beachgoers and tourists. The fall season is equally beautiful, with clear skies and comfortable temperatures, ideal for outdoor activities. 3. Temperature Trends: Understanding the Year-Round Patterns
Understanding Dalian’s temperature trends is key to navigating the city’s climate. The average annual temperature hovers around 11°C, with significant variations between summer and winter. The hottest months are July and August, when temperatures can reach up to 25°C, while January and February are the coldest, with averages around -5°C. 🌡️
